Sowing & Growing
Plant her outdoors from March to September and watch her settle in, stretching just enough to show off that perfectly formed shape. Give her about 20 cm — she likes to stay tight, but she still wants room to flaunt what she’s got. Thin her early and she’ll only come back firmer, fuller, and far more tempting, responding eagerly to every bit of attention you give her.
Care & Conditions
Keep her soil teasingly moist — never heavy — just enough to keep her fresh, crisp, and ready. She thrives in cooler weather with a touch of shade, holding her shape while slowly filling out. Treat her right and she’ll reward you with tender, juicy leaves that practically invite your touch. Keep her protected and keep sowing — she’s more than happy to keep things going as long as you are.
Harvesting
Take her when she’s tight, tender, and just the right size — around 15–20 cm of crisp, juicy perfection. Pick her outer leaves for a slow, teasing nibble, or cut her low when you want more.
